Output 576ce23ecbe30d1c16d1654afb3c3b6e6d2f489f8bc5d7051bce9b314e454e89:0

value
21007279
script pubkey
OP_0 OP_PUSHBYTES_20 54d8df30463500f2c3fca9971bc69bf2602e5f87
address
ltc1q2nvd7vzxx5q09slu4xt3h35m7fszuhu8a3wzq4
transaction
576ce23ecbe30d1c16d1654afb3c3b6e6d2f489f8bc5d7051bce9b314e454e89
spent
true